Edarbi and Anxiety: What Users Say

Anxiety: mentioned by 3 users (6.7%)

Based on user experiences from 45 Edarbi reviews, the following table shows the most commonly mentioned side effects.

All user comments are moderated by Drugs.com. Each review is verified for relevance and screened for inappropriate content. Side effects are user-reported and not clinically verified.

dizziness 17.8%
tiredness 17.8%
fatigue 13.3%
chest pain 8.9%
depression 8.9%
insomnia 8.9%
anxiety 6.7%
back pain 6.7%
headaches 6.7%
lightheadedness 6.7%

For High Blood Pressure "Have never felt the same since being on Edarbi. Numbers went low, so went on half dose. Still low. The drug made me tired and totally fatigued. Lightheaded, also jittery feeling. I stopped it a week ago and hope it leaves my system soon. Also had tummy problems with it."

For High Blood Pressure "I took it upon myself to seek out a cardiologist who is known as more respected in the cause and cure of high blood pressure. After an office visit, the doctor prescribed two drugs, one being Edarbi 80, I began the regimen. Edarbi has turned me upside down. I can't believe the side effects from Edarbi are such that I went into deep depression and anxiety, and my BP numbers weren't too much lower than with my primary doctor's regimen. I cannot sleep longer than 2 to 4 hours a night, and I am tired to the point of exhaustion. I am getting off Edarbi 40/25 immediately and try to get off these drugs that may help a very few individuals who, because they believe a doctor, will suffer long-term and severe mental and physical psychosis and may harbor suicidal thoughts. Don't be a guinea pig."
